rescindir

to rescind

verb rres-een-DEER Rare

Origin: From Latin rescindere (to cut off, annul).

Also means

to cancel (a contract)

Usage Note

Rescindir is a formal legal verb used specifically for canceling contracts, agreements, or obligations — rescindir un contrato. It is stronger and more formal than cancelar and implies legal grounds for the termination.

Examples

"La empresa decidió rescindir el contrato."

Natural Translation

The company decided to rescind the contract.
